Skip to content
Snippets Groups Projects
Commit ea6a595f authored by Loïc Poullain's avatar Loïc Poullain
Browse files

Replace plfToAmendement with baseToPlf

parent 6821a01c
No related branches found
No related tags found
1 merge request!59[DSR] Utiliser la réponse de la requête simulation
......@@ -60,7 +60,7 @@ L'état redux est en cours de re-factorisation. Voici la manière dont il se pr
- baseToPlf # Résultats comparant le PLF avec le code existant
- ir
- dotations
- plfToAmendement # Résultats comparant le PLF avec les valeurs proposées par l'utilisateur
- baseToAmendement # Résultats comparant les valeurs proposées par l'utilisateur avec le code existant
- ir
- dotations
- interfaces # Descriptions des états (identiques dans amendement, base et plf)
......
......@@ -13,9 +13,9 @@ import { RootState } from "../../../../redux/reducers";
import { ConnectedProps, connect } from "react-redux";
const mapStateToProps = ({ results }: RootState) => ({
nouvellementEligibles: results.plfToAmendement.dotations.state?.communes.dsr.nouvellementEligibles,
plusEligibles: results.plfToAmendement.dotations.state?.communes.dsr.plusEligibles,
toujoursEligibles: results.plfToAmendement.dotations.state?.communes.dsr.toujoursEligibles,
nouvellementEligibles: results.baseToAmendement.dotations.state?.communes.dsr.nouvellementEligibles,
plusEligibles: results.baseToAmendement.dotations.state?.communes.dsr.plusEligibles,
toujoursEligibles: results.baseToAmendement.dotations.state?.communes.dsr.toujoursEligibles,
})
const connector = connect(mapStateToProps);
......
......@@ -60,15 +60,7 @@ interface ResponseBody {
}
}
}
plfToAmendement: {
communes: {
dsr: {
nouvellementEligibles: number;
plusEligibles: number;
toujoursEligibles: number;
}
}
}
baseToAmendement: ResponseBody["baseToPlf"]
}
export interface SimulateDotationsSuccessAction {
......
......@@ -44,7 +44,7 @@ export function dotations(
case "SIMULATE_DOTATIONS_SUCCESS":
return {
isFetching: false,
state: action.dotations.plfToAmendement,
state: action.dotations.baseToAmendement,
};
default:
return state;
......
......@@ -2,6 +2,6 @@ import { combineReducers } from "redux";
import { dotations } from "./dotations";
export const plfToAmendement = combineReducers({
export const baseToAmendement = combineReducers({
dotations,
});
......@@ -5,13 +5,13 @@ import { base } from "./base";
import { baseToPlf } from "./baseToPlf";
import casTypes from "./cas-types";
import { plf } from "./plf";
import { plfToAmendement } from "./plfToAmendement";
import { baseToAmendement } from "./baseToAmendement";
export default combineReducers({
amendement,
base,
baseToAmendement,
baseToPlf,
casTypes,
plf,
plfToAmendement,
});
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ment